Understanding Eczema

Eczema, or atopic dermatitis, is a chronic skin condition characterized by inflammation, redness, and persistent itching. It affects individuals of all ages, from infants to adults, and is often associated with genetic, environmental, and immune system factors. Types of Eczema Eczema encompasses several types, each with unique causes and symptoms:
Atopic Dermatitis: The most common form of eczema linked to allergies like asthma or hay fever. Symptoms include dry, itchy skin, often appearing on the face, elbows, and behind the knees.
Contact Dermatitis: Results from exposure to irritants (detergents, chemicals) or allergens (nickel, fragrances). Symptoms range from redness and swelling to blistering.
Dyshidrotic Eczema: Small, itchy hand and foot blisters, often triggered by stress or moisture.
Nummular Eczema: Coin-shaped spots of itchy, inflamed skin, often caused by skin injuries or excessive dryness.
Stasis Dermatitis: Affects the lower legs due to poor circulation, causing redness, swelling, and scaling.
Seborrheic Dermatitis: Flaky, scaly patches on oily areas of the body like the scalp and face, associated with Malassezia yeast overgrowth.

Common Symptoms of Eczema Eczema symptoms vary but often include:

  • Persistent itching
  • Red, inflamed skin
  • Dry, scaly patches
  • Fluid-filled blisters that may ooze or crust over
  • Thickened, leathery skin from chronic scratching

Symptoms can range from mild to severe and may fluctuate depending on environmental factors and other triggers.

Diagnosis of Eczema At Dermestetics, we focus on accurate diagnosis through:

  • Comprehensive Consultation: Reviewing medical history, lifestyle, and symptoms.
  • Patch Testing: Identifying potential allergens that may trigger contact dermatitis.
  • Skin Biopsy: In rare cases, a biopsy may be performed to rule out other skin conditions, such as psoriasis.

Step 2: Personalized Treatment Plan

Based on your diagnosis, we craft a treatment plan that may include:

  • Topical Corticosteroids: To diminish inflammation and alleviate itching.
  • Topical Calcineurin Inhibitors: Non-steroidal options like tacrolimus for sensitive areas.
  • Emollients and Moisturizers: Essential for restoring the skin’s natural barrier and retaining hydration.
  • Antihistamines: For managing nighttime itching.
  • Phototherapy: Controlled exposure to UV light for severe cases.
  • Biologic Therapies: Advanced treatments such as dupilumab for moderate to severe eczema.
  • Systemic Immunosuppressants: For cases unresponsive to topical treatments.

Preventive Tips for Managing Eczema Taking proactive steps can help minimize eczema flare-ups:

  • Moisturize daily using fragrance-free products.
  • Avoid known triggers, such as allergens and irritants.
  • Wear breathable fabrics like cotton to reduce skin irritation.
  • Use mild soaps and avoid harsh detergents.
  • Practice stress management through mindfulness or yoga.
